大家好,我一直在嘗試抓取一些包含不斷變化的值的網(wǎng)頁,但到目前為止我無法獲得價格。任何人都可以幫助我,這是我到目前為止到達(dá)的地方!import requestsimport bs4from urllib.request import Request, urlopen as uReqfrom bs4 import BeautifulSoup as soup from selenium import webdriverfrom selenium.webdriver.firefox.firefox_binary import FirefoxBinaryfrom selenium.webdriver.firefox.options import Optionsfrom selenium.webdriver.common.desired_capabilities import DesiredCapabilitiesmy_url = 'https://www.cryptocompare.com/'binary = FirefoxBinary('C:/Program Files/Mozilla Firefox/firefox.exe')options = Options()options.set_headless(headless=True)options.binary = binarycap = DesiredCapabilities().FIREFOXcap["marionette"] = Truedriver = webdriver.Firefox(firefox_options=options, capabilities=cap, executable_path="C:/Users/Genti/AppData/Local/Programs/Python/Python36-32/Lib/site-packages/selenium/geckodriver.exe")browser = webdriver.Firefox(firefox_binary=binary)browser.get(my_url)html = browser.execute_script("return document.documentElement.outerHTML")sel_soup = soup(html, 'html.parser')prices = sel_soup.findAll("td", {"class":"price"})print(prices)
動態(tài)值網(wǎng)頁抓取
慕尼黑8549860
2021-09-14 13:45:56